High-pressure soft sealing manual fixing ball valve
By adopting an integrated structure design of the ball and support shaft and a floating valve seat made of PEEK material, the sealing and operation problems of traditional fixed ball valves in high-pressure hydrogen environments are solved, achieving efficient fluid control and convenient maintenance.

AI Technical Summary
Traditional fixed ball valves are not compact in high-pressure hydrogen environments, have poor sealing performance, are heavy, are cumbersome to operate, and have large driving torque, making it difficult to achieve rapid opening and closing and convenient maintenance.
It adopts an integrated structure design of ball and support shaft, combined with sealing ring and floating valve seat made of PEEK material, and uses disc spring to provide pre-tightening force to achieve reliable sealing. The fluid passage is controlled by rotating the ball through the handle.
It features a compact structure, good sealing performance, light weight, low driving torque, simple operation, easy and quick opening and closing and maintenance, and facilitates fluid control of high-pressure gas media.

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of ball valve technology, and in particular to a high-pressure soft-seal manually fixed ball valve. Background Technology
[0002] In the field of hydrogen energy applications, ball valves are widely used in equipment and pipelines of 35MPa and 70MPa hydrogen refueling stations, such as hydrogen booster stations, high-flow mobile hydrogen booster systems, and high-pressure pipelines. They are primarily used as manual shut-off valves, handling high-pressure gases such as hydrogen as the main medium. The operating temperature range is -40℃ to +85℃, and the pressure rating can reach 20000PSI (138MPa). The main body is made of strain-strengthened 316 / 316 stainless steel to avoid the potential hazards of hydrogen embrittlement caused by high-pressure hydrogen. The connecting pipe size is between 1 / 4″ and 1″, with a compact overall structure and a fixed ball soft seal structure, ensuring reliable sealing performance.
[0003] Traditional fixed ball valves use a ball with two supporting shafts as the opening and closing element, with a channel in the middle equal to the pipe diameter. The ball rotates 90° around the valve stem axis to open and close the passage. This design is not compact, has poor sealing, is heavy, has a large driving torque, is cumbersome to operate, and is not easy to achieve quick opening and closing or convenient maintenance. To address these issues, we propose a soft-seal manual fixed ball valve for high pressure applications. Utility Model Content

[0012] Compared with the prior art, the beneficial effects of this utility model are:
[0013] This device adopts an integrated structure design of sphere and support shaft, which features compact structure, good sealing performance, light weight, small driving torque, simple operation, easy to achieve rapid start and stop and convenient maintenance. It is suitable for high-pressure gas media.
[0014] By turning the handle, the valve stem drives the ball to rotate, thereby changing the shape of the channel inside the valve body and realizing the on-off control of fluid. The valve seat of the fixed ball valve is floating. The valve seat assembly is made of metal support ring inlaid with PEEK. The preload is provided by the combined disc spring behind the valve seat support ring. At the same time, under the action of the medium force, both the front and rear valve seats can provide reliable sealing, which can ensure that the valve has good sealing performance in the closed state. [0020] Please see Figure 1-2 In this utility model, a high-pressure soft-seal manual fixed ball valve includes a valve body 1. The valve body 1 is provided with a thrust pad 15, a bearing seat 16, a bearing 17, a valve stem 13 and a ball 19. A lower end cover 20 is provided below the valve body 1. The lower end cover 20 is fastened to the valve body 1 by threads.
[0021] Both the upper and lower ends of the valve body 1 are provided with O-rings 2 and retaining rings 4. The sealing of the upper and lower ends of the valve body 1 is achieved by O-rings 2 and retaining rings 4. The O-ring 2 outside the valve stem 13 is a dynamic seal, with two sealing rings to ensure reliable sealing throughout the service life. The O-ring 2 outside the lower end cover 20 is a static seal, with a single sealing ring design.
[0022] The valve seat assembly consists of a retainer 5, a sealing ring 8, a disc spring 7, a thrust ring 6, an O-ring 2, and a retaining ring 4. The sealing ring 8 is made of PEEK, which provides both strength and a soft seal, ensuring a reliable seal. The Z-shaped thrust ring 6 ensures sufficient contact width with the disc spring 7 and full contact with the O-ring 2 and retaining ring 4. At the same time, the inner diameter of the thrust ring 6 has sufficient contact length with the valve seat, ensuring the stability of the valve seat. The valve seat O-ring 2 and sealing ring 8 are designed with a double piston effect, ensuring a seal regardless of whether the medium enters from the left end, the right end, or both ends simultaneously, and also ensuring a seal even when the medium in the middle cavity is empty.
[0023] End caps 18 are installed on both sides of the valve body 1. The valve body 1 and the end caps 18 are sealed by O-rings 2. The valve seat assembly and the end caps 18 are installed sequentially from both sides of the valve body 1. Finally, the valve body 1 is fastened to the end caps 18 by the threads. The seals between the end caps 18 and the valve body 1 and between the valve seat assembly and the end caps 18 are also sealed by O-rings 2.
[0024] A handle seat 12 is fitted onto the valve stem 13 and connected to it as a whole by screws 11. A pin 10 is provided between the valve body 1 and the handle seat 12. The pin 10 can be used to reinforce the handle seat 12 and the valve body 1. The handle seat 12 is connected to the handle 14 by internal hex screws. An open retaining ring 3 is provided inside the valve body 1. A set of fixing nuts 9 is provided on the outside of the valve body 1.
